Leave Your Dog In Safe Hands
Pet care experience
I have my own staffy cross rescue, she is my fur baby so I understand that your dog is a part of your family. I have experience caring for dogs that may be anxious, over excitable or reactive. I have cared for puppies, elderly dogs and groups of 5 dogs.

My services extend from drop-in visits to day-long company for your dog(s) in your own home, as often and for as long as required. When I visit your fur baby I can feed your dog (including give them medication), play with them, give plenty of cuddles and daily exercise. I will clear up any of their mess. I will send you photos and message updates, so you can hear what your happy dog has been up to, and/or if you are away we can video call. I can do small jobs around the house such as collecting the mail and watering the plants.
Information Kirsty C. would like to know about your pet
I am happy to care for dogs that display behavioural problems and have medical issues At our meet-and-greet I will ask a series of questions about your dog’s personality and behaviours, so that I am informed on any important information.
A typical day
We can play your dogs' favourite games, work on learning new training commands and have plenty of cuddles. We can go on walking routes your dog is familiar with, and/or explore new territory if your dog can travel in the car. At the end of the walk, I will give the dog a wipe down to ensure your house stays clean.

I am currently offering my services in Belper and surrounding areas. I work 7am-8pm (excluding overnight stays), 7 days a week. I run my own business offering dog care, so my priority is to give you and your dog the best experience. For house sits. I will stay with your dog for most of the day. I may leave for other jobs for periods of 3-4 hours, for example left between; 9-11am and 2-5pm.
